Steps to Create a Google Cloud Platform Account

1️⃣ Visit the Google Cloud Platform website by typing “cloud.google.com” in your web browser’s URL bar and press Enter. Once on the website, locate and click on the “Get started for free” button to begin the account creation process.

2️⃣ Fill in the required information on the registration form. This includes providing your email address, creating a strong password, and selecting your country of residence. It is important to choose an email address that you have access to and can verify, as this will be used for account-related communications.

3️⃣ Read and agree to the Google Cloud Platform Terms of Service by checking the box. These terms outline the legal agreement between you and Google regarding the use of their services. Once you have reviewed and accepted the terms, click on the “Agree and create account” button to proceed.

Verifying and Accessing Your Google Cloud Platform Account

1️⃣ Check your email inbox for a verification message from Google Cloud Platform. This email will contain a link that you need to click on to verify your email address and activate your account. It is essential to complete this step to ensure the security and validity of your account.

2️⃣ Click on the verification link provided in the email. This will redirect you to a confirmation page, indicating that your email address has been successfully verified. You may also be prompted to provide additional information or complete any necessary setup steps at this stage.

3️⃣ Once your account is activated, you can access the Google Cloud Platform console by visiting the login page and entering your registered email address and password. This console serves as the centralized hub for managing and utilizing Google Cloud Platform’s resources and services.

Advanced Analytics Capabilities

?

Another key feature of Google Cloud Platform is its advanced analytics capabilities. With tools like BigQuery and Cloud Dataflow, businesses can gain valuable insights from their data through complex data analysis and visualization.

BigQuery, a fully managed and serverless data warehouse, enables you to run fast, SQL-like queries over large datasets. This powerful analytics tool allows you to uncover patterns, trends, and relationships hidden within your data, empowering you to make data-driven decisions. Additionally, Cloud Dataflow provides a fully managed service for transforming and enriching large datasets in real-time, enabling you to extract valuable insights quickly.

These advanced analytics capabilities offered by Google Cloud Platform give businesses the opportunity to harness the power of their data and drive innovation by making informed decisions based on actionable insights. The platform’s robust analytics tools put data at your fingertips, enabling you to uncover trends, identify opportunities, and optimize business processes.

Secure Data Storage Options

?

When it comes to storing your valuable data, security is of utmost importance. Google Cloud Platform offers a variety of secure data storage options to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of your data.

Cloud Storage is a highly scalable and durable object storage service that allows you to store and retrieve data from anywhere in the world. It offers strong consistency, global redundancy, and advanced security features such as encryption at rest and in transit, access controls, and audit logs. With Cloud Storage, you can have peace of mind knowing that your data is highly protected.

Cloud SQL, on the other hand, is a fully managed relational database service that offers the familiarity of traditional MySQL and PostgreSQL databases. It provides automated backups, high availability, and built-in security features, such as encryption and access controls. By leveraging Cloud SQL, you can confidently store and manage your structured data in a secure and scalable manner.

Cost Management in Google Cloud Platform

Understanding Pricing Models

Google Cloud Platform offers flexible pricing models, including pay-as-you-go and committed use discounts. These pricing models allow users to choose the most cost-effective solution for their specific needs. The pay-as-you-go model allows users to pay only for the resources they use, with no upfront commitment. This model is suitable for businesses with unpredictable or fluctuating workloads. On the other hand, the committed use discounts model offers discounted prices for users who commit to using specific resources for a longer period, such as one or three years. This model is suitable for businesses with a steady workload and can result in significant cost savings.

Monitoring and Managing Costs

To effectively monitor and manage costs in Google Cloud Platform, users can utilize various tools and features provided by the platform. One of these tools is Google Cloud Billing, which allows users to track their usage and spending in real-time. With Google Cloud Billing, users can set budget alerts to receive notifications when their spending reaches a certain threshold. This feature helps users stay within their budget and avoid unexpected costs. Additionally, users can analyze cost trends and identify areas where optimization is possible. By understanding their usage patterns and making informed decisions, users can effectively manage their costs in Google Cloud Platform.

Best Practices for Cost Optimization

To optimize costs in Google Cloud Platform, it is important to follow best practices and implement cost-saving strategies. Regularly reviewing resource usage is crucial to identify any unnecessary or underutilized resources that can be removed or downsized. Right-sizing instances involves selecting the appropriate virtual machine size for each workload to avoid overprovisioning. This helps to optimize costs by reducing unnecessary resource allocation. Additionally, users can leverage cost-effective storage options, such as Google Cloud Storage Nearline or Coldline, for less frequently accessed data.

Automating resource allocation can also contribute to cost optimization. Users can utilize automation tools, such as Google Cloud Deployment Manager or Terraform, to provision and manage resources efficiently. These tools allow users to define infrastructure as code, making it easier to replicate and scale resources as needed. By automating resource allocation, users can ensure efficient resource utilization and avoid manual errors that may lead to additional costs.

Compute Engine

? Compute Engine is a virtual machine (VM) infrastructure in Google Cloud Platform (GCP). It allows you to create and manage VM instances, customize machine types, and configure networking for your applications.

With Compute Engine, you can easily spin up virtual machines with various operating systems, such as Windows or Linux, in a matter of minutes. These VM instances can be customized based on your application’s requirements, including CPU, memory, and disk size.

? One of the key benefits of Compute Engine is its scalability. You can easily scale your VM instances vertically by increasing the resources allocated to them or horizontally by adding more instances to your infrastructure.

Compute Engine also provides seamless integration with other GCP services, such as Cloud Storage and BigQuery, enabling you to build a comprehensive and scalable cloud-based solution for your applications.

BigQuery

? BigQuery is a fully managed, serverless data warehouse solution offered by Google Cloud Platform. It allows you to analyze massive datasets quickly and efficiently using the power of Google’s infrastructure.

BigQuery uses a distributed architecture to perform queries on large datasets in parallel, enabling fast query execution. You can load your data into BigQuery from various sources, including CSV files, JSON files, and even directly from Google Sheets.

? Once the data is loaded into BigQuery, you can run SQL-like queries to retrieve meaningful insights from your data. BigQuery supports standard SQL syntax as well as advanced features like window functions and nested queries.

To visualize and share the results of your queries, you can use tools like Data Studio, which provides a user-friendly interface for creating interactive dashboards and reports.

Cloud Storage

☁️ Cloud Storage is a scalable and secure object storage service in Google Cloud Platform. It offers a simple and cost-effective solution for storing and retrieving your data in the cloud.

Cloud Storage allows you to store and access your data globally, making it ideal for building applications with a global user base. It provides strong data consistency and durability, ensuring that your data is always available and protected.

? Access control is another important aspect of Cloud Storage. You can define fine-grained access permissions to your data at the bucket and object levels. This allows you to restrict access to sensitive data and ensure data security.

Cloud Storage also supports data lifecycle management, which enables you to automate the movement of data between different storage classes based on predefined rules. This helps optimize storage costs and align data access requirements with storage costs.

? In addition to its standalone capabilities, Cloud Storage integrates seamlessly with other Google Cloud services like Compute Engine and BigQuery. This integration enables you to build end-to-end solutions, leveraging the strengths of each service.
